1996 Concorde
Am waiting on a quote from my NAPA mechanic, but I'd like to ask here
as a comparison. What would be a fair price to replace the timing belt on the 3.5 V6 engine? This is assuming that there are no unusual difficulties encountered. The vehicle currently has more than 156,000 miles. Thanks. GrtArtiste |

1996 Concorde
GrtArtiste wrote:
> Am waiting on a quote from my NAPA mechanic, but I'd like to ask here > as a comparison. What would be a fair price to replace the timing belt > on the 3.5 V6 engine? This is assuming that there are no unusual > difficulties encountered. The vehicle currently has more than 156,000 > miles. Thanks. > > GrtArtiste I would say between $600 and $950 part and labor. You are planning to also replace the water pump while in there, right? It is driven by the timing belt. That price range should include that Hambone |

That price range should include that > > Hambone Oh - also, definitely replace the timing belt tensioner pulley (might come with bracket). The hydraulic tensioner generally does not give problems if the engine has been properly and regularly maintained (oil and oil filter changes) - your decision whether to replace that or not - it is one of the more expensive parts - it's a "dealer only" item. |
